Exactly how to Locate a Specialist
The appropriate specialist will certainly help you navigate the turbulent waters of life's challenges. Picking the appropriate one starts with discovering their baseline credentials and area of proficiency.


Psychologists hold postgraduate degrees, while qualified medical social workers and therapists hold master's levels. Searching online directories like Psychology Today can help narrow your selections by zip code, specialty and treatment design.

References
Obtaining a referral from a trusted resource can be handy when searching for a therapist. Buddies, family members and primary care companies can give referrals based on their experiences with specific therapists or certain obstacles. While their opinions and experiences are essential, it is likewise essential to consider your very own preferences and needs when choosing which therapists might be best for you.

Group Practices
While a private practice can function well for therapists, it requires time to develop a client base and manage business elements of billing, bargaining with insurance provider and scheduling a space. On top of that, therapists typically intend to focus on the healing process rather than taking care of company matters.

Therefore, they may not have availability to meet you at your request or their cost may be outdoors your budget plan. A group practice allows a specialist to deal with numerous customers at the same time and share the management tasks, which can make them more readily available to you.

You can likewise use a group practice to discover a therapist that is familiar with your details problem or therapy style. As an example, you may choose a medical professional who has experience dealing with anxiety problems or a therapist that focuses on family therapy.

Insurance
Obtaining the most out of insurance coverage can be a challenge. Relying on your coverage, it might be difficult to discover a therapist who takes your insurance policy or whose rates fit within your spending plan. Utilizing online directory psychological support sites that search for suppliers who approve your specific insurance coverage or a free service like BetterHelp, 7 Favorites or Talkspace can save time, however it's still important to get in touch with your potential specialist straight to ensure they are the appropriate match for you.

Some specialists pick not to take insurance coverage as a result of the inconvenience of payment, delays in repayment and "clawbacks" (when an insurer declares back repayments up to 5 years after solutions are offered). Likewise, several therapists make use of a sliding scale, which differs based upon income, to assist customers afford treatment.

If you do not have insurance policy, think about connecting to a charitable organization that supports psychological wellness or to your local neighborhood university, where students may supply discounted treatment sessions. Also, contact your employer's Worker Aid Program to see if they offer a specialist on their list of authorized carriers.
